Dr. Eli Goldratt - Keynote Speaker:
Dr. Eli Goldratt's Theory of Constraints (TOC) is used by thousands of companies around the world. His work as a best-selling author, educator and business pioneer has resulted in the introduction of TOC into many facets of American and international business. Dr. Goldratt will share his latest work, and the subject of his new book...

Necessary but not sufficient, from MRP to E-Business
In today's dot com frenzied environment, we must constantly ask if we need new technology, what technology, and when, if our organization is to succeed and grow. Caution is required, however. Our experience has proven time and again that new technology alone is far from sufficient to yield bottom line results from our IT investments. Dr. Goldratt will review the role and contribution of computer technology to organizations from a holistic TOC perspective, providing insight on how to make IT investments pay off. You will be challenged to examine and reassess your business practices with this fresh perspective.

If you've ever seen Dr. Goldratt present, you know to expect anything but a summary of his book. He's sure to rant, rave, surprise, inspire and educate his audience -- all at once!

TP Recertification - Jonahs Only

Facilitated by Bill McClelland, Executive Director - AGI

Jonahs: In the early 90s, hooking up to and communicating over the Internet was reserved for brave technical innovators with considerable patience and a strong tolerance for frustration and "hardness of use." During the middle 90s, the base technology became easier to use, rapidly expanding through the population of early adopters. By the turn of the century, Internet use was pervasive among the world population, claiming broad base support from the ranks of the very young to the very old. A multi-billion dollar e-commerce industry enjoyed unprecedented and explosive growth.

On a slightly smaller scale, the TOC Thinking Processes have gone through an amazingly parallel evolution. Jonahs from the early 90s - the brave (and sometimes not so patient) innovators - did experience considerable frustration at early TP "hardness of use." Things got easier during the middle 90s as increasingly more was learned about how much rigor was "good enough." By the turn of the century,

  • the 3 Cloud Approach had replaced "diving down into the unknown" in search of a Core Problem,
  • a multi-pass construction method dramatically sped up the process for creating Current and Future Reality Trees, and
  • the specific identification of policies, measurements, and behaviors provided a much more powerful basis for successful change.

These breakthroughs and many more have made the TP easier, faster, and more powerful to use. Life has never been easier for first time users or for Jonahs who need to use the full TP roadmap in a group setting.

If it has been over two years since you took a good, hard look at the TOC Thinking Processes; if you want to refresh your basic understanding of the TP; if you want "hands-on" experience with the new ease of use; or, if you want to learn important tips on how to use the TP in a group setting, this interactive session is definitely for you!
